add ipmi sensor data to gnocchi
we've been missing this data for a while. Change-Id: I0df15c3e2f4ce98a41320a711e1f18d2c5d7c34d Related-Bug: #1746736
This commit is contained in:
parent
5349338114
commit
663c523328
@ -197,6 +197,13 @@ resources_update_operations = [
|
|||||||
"attributes": {"provider": {"type": "string", "min_length": 0,
|
"attributes": {"provider": {"type": "string", "min_length": 0,
|
||||||
"max_length": 255, "required": True}}
|
"max_length": 255, "required": True}}
|
||||||
}]},
|
}]},
|
||||||
|
{"desc": "add ipmi sensor resource type",
|
||||||
|
"type": "create_resource_type",
|
||||||
|
"resource_type": "ipmi_sensor",
|
||||||
|
"data": [{
|
||||||
|
"attributes": {"node": {"type": "string", "min_length": 0,
|
||||||
|
"max_length": 255, "required": True}}
|
||||||
|
}]},
|
||||||
]
|
]
|
||||||
|
|
||||||
# NOTE(sileht): We use LooseVersion because pbr can generate invalid
|
# NOTE(sileht): We use LooseVersion because pbr can generate invalid
|
||||||
|
@ -145,6 +145,15 @@ resources:
|
|||||||
- 'hardware.ipmi.node.mem_util'
|
- 'hardware.ipmi.node.mem_util'
|
||||||
- 'hardware.ipmi.node.io_util'
|
- 'hardware.ipmi.node.io_util'
|
||||||
|
|
||||||
|
- resource_type: ipmi_sensor
|
||||||
|
metrics:
|
||||||
|
- 'hardware.ipmi.power'
|
||||||
|
- 'hardware.ipmi.temperature'
|
||||||
|
- 'hardware.ipmi.current'
|
||||||
|
- 'hardware.ipmi.voltage'
|
||||||
|
attributes:
|
||||||
|
node: resource_metadata.node
|
||||||
|
|
||||||
- resource_type: network
|
- resource_type: network
|
||||||
metrics:
|
metrics:
|
||||||
- 'bandwidth'
|
- 'bandwidth'
|
||||||
|
@ -0,0 +1,8 @@
|
|||||||
|
---
|
||||||
|
upgrade:
|
||||||
|
- |
|
||||||
|
`ceilometer-upgrade` must be run to build IPMI sensor resource in Gnocchi.
|
||||||
|
fixes:
|
||||||
|
- |
|
||||||
|
Ceilometer previously did not create IPMI sensor data from IPMI agent or
|
||||||
|
Ironic in Gnocchi. This data is now pushed to Gnocchi.
|
Loading…
x
Reference in New Issue
Block a user